Creating hyperlinks in your web content is an effective way to capture your reader's attention, keep the content interactive, and provide useful information and resources for your website visitors. Our advice: Use hyperlinks liberally!
To create a hyperlink, simply select the text string (highlight entire text string you wish to link) or image you would like to link from, and click the "Create Hyperlink" icon in the tool bar of the advanced HTML editor, shaped like a chain link.

The web page dialog window for the "Create Hyperlink" tool will open, prompting you to enter the desired URL. Enter the exact full URL you intend to link to. Select "default" as the target for web pages within your own website that you are linking to, and select "blanK" as the target for external web pages on other websites. Click "Ok" and your link will be created.
Please note that you cannot test links from within the editor, but you should be sure to test them through the public browser view of your web page, or through the "View Content" page within the NControl menu.
Linking to documents (pdfs, docs, spreadsheets, etc.) on your website is easy too. Simply FTP the file to a directory on your website (see FTP help file) and then enter the URL for the specific file you want to link to (ie. http://www.yourdomain.com/pdfs/Report.pdf ).
